在labview中增加数据采集的延迟

时间:2016-04-25 23:09:53

标签: signal-processing delay labview data-acquisition

(抱歉,由于我的声望级别低于10,我无法发布图片)

我想要做的是,我希望我的激光位移daq在另一个daq采集开始采集数据后一秒钟后开始采集数据。

我无法在激光位移daq上添加延迟。 (两种方法都应该运行10秒钟,激光位移daq在获取数据时应该晚1秒。)

由于

2 个答案:

答案 0 :(得分:2)

有不同的方法可以做到这一点。这有两个想法:

  1. 获取两者的11秒数据,并从激光器中丢弃前1秒的数据。

  2. 使用Time Delay Express VI和连线来控制代码执行的顺序,如@nekomatic所建议:enter image description here(注意:我的原始代码,使用序列结构和等待(ms) )功能,位于http://i.stack.imgur.com/9pIwb.png

答案 1 :(得分:1)

您可以考虑使用 DAQmx触发器启动延迟属性节点

Here你可以找到一个完整的例子。

here来自National Instruments on Task synchronization的一个很好的教程。